The Role of Substrate Composition in Oyster Mushroom Growth

When it comes to growing oyster mushrooms, the substrate you use makes a huge difference in how well they grow and how much you end up with. Using the right materials like straw, sawdust, or agricultural waste is super important because these give the mushrooms the nutrients and moisture they need to colonize properly. I read in the Journal of Fungi that substrates high in lignin and cellulose really help Pleurotus ostreatus, a popular oyster mushroom variety, grow faster. In fact, if your substrate has about 65% lignin, you might see yields go up by as much as 30% compared to substrates with less lignin—pretty impressive, right?

And don’t forget about moisture! Keeping the substrate’s moisture level around 60-70% is key, according to a study in the International Journal of Mushroom Sciences. Too little or too much moisture can slow down growth or even invite unwanted contaminants or molds. So, understanding what your mushrooms need in terms of substrate composition and moisture is crucial if you want a good, consistent harvest that's high quality. Common Substrate Issues That Affect Yield Quality

When you're growing oyster mushrooms, the kind of substrate you choose can really make a difference in how good and plentiful your harvest turns out to be. One common hiccup folks run into is contamination—stuff like mold and bacteria that can fight your mushrooms for nutrients. That can really slow down their growth or even cut yields short. To keep this in check, it's smart to keep everything as sterile as possible during prep and when you're inoculating. Using high-quality, well-pasteurized substrates is also a big help in avoiding those pesky contaminants.

Another issue that pops up often is moisture—if the substrate doesn’t hold enough water, your mushrooms won’t flourish. They love a damp environment, so if the substrate dries out, it can really put a damper on the mycelium's spread and fruiting. To prevent this, it's a good idea to go for like straw or sawdust, which hold onto moisture pretty well. And don’t forget to check the hydration levels before you inoculate! Keeping an eye on the moisture during growth can save you from problems like the substrate drying out completely or becoming too soggy, which can cause nutrient leaching or rot.

Lastly, tuning the substrate’s recipe is super important. If it lacks the right nutrients, your mushrooms might not develop properly. So, aiming for a balanced mix of carbon and nitrogen sources is key. Adding in some wheat bran or similar supplements can bump up the nutritional value, encouraging stronger growth and helping you maximize your yield. Identifying Contamination Problems in Mushroom Cultivation

Contamination is a pretty big hurdle when it comes to growing mushrooms, especially oyster mushrooms. The substrate—the stuff they grow on—really impacts how much you get and the quality of the mushrooms. Honestly, studies show that almost 30% of mushroom growers run into serious issues because of mold and bacteria messing things up. One common troublemaker is Trichoderma, which can outcompete your mushrooms for nutrients, leading to smaller yields and weaker fruiting bodies. The good news? According to the American Mushroom Institute, if you handle your substrate properly—like sterilizing it well and keeping moisture in check—you can cut down these risks a lot.

Spotting contamination early on is super important if you want to keep your harvests up. It’s a good idea to do regular checks and some microbiological tests on your substrate. There was this study in the Journal of Fungal Biology that showed substrates treated with high-pressure steam had contamination problems in just about 5% of cases, while untreated ones had rates as high as 50%. So, understanding what’s causing these issues—things like not pasteurizing properly or handling the substrate wrong—can help you adopt smarter practices. That way, your oyster mushrooms stay healthy, and your yields will probably get a boost too.

Evaluating Nutritional Needs of Oyster Mushrooms for Optimal Yield

So, when it comes to growing oyster mushrooms, understanding their nutritional needs really makes a big difference if you're aiming for a good harvest. It’s super important to get a handle on what’s in the substrate because that’s what actually influences how well the mushrooms grow and how much you might get in the end. Luckily, there are plenty of locally available materials you can use—think agricultural wastes or even water hyacinth—that can be added to boost the nutrient content. It’s a pretty smart way to make farming more sustainable, especially when you’re using resources that might otherwise get tossed out.

Lately, people have been experimenting with mixing different kinds of substrates, and it turns out this can really help improve yields. For example, combining agriwastes with water hyacinth creates a nutrient-rich mix that supports healthier fungi and better growth. Trying out different combinations helps farmers figure out what works best, so they can get higher harvests without racking up extra costs. Exploring new substrate ideas is really the key to growing top-quality oyster mushrooms—plus, it’s a step toward farming that's better for the planet too.
